#613cd9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#613cd9 is composed of 38% red, 23.5% green and 85.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55.3% cyan, 72.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 254.1 degrees, a saturation of 67.4% and a lightness of 54.3%. #613cd9 color hex could be obtained by blending #c278ff with #0000b3.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

#613cd9 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#613cd9 has RGB values of R:97, G:60, B:217 and CMYK values of C:0.55, M:0.72, Y:0,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 6372569.

Shades and Tints of #613cd9
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010002 is the darkest color, while #f3f1f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#613cd9
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#878491 is the less saturated color, while #4e18fd is the most saturated one.
